Almond Butter and Chia Jam Bars With Chocolate [Vegan]

Ingredients

For the Almond Butter Base:

  • 1 cups rolled oats
  • 1/2 cup almond butter
  • 1 tablespoon maple syrup
  • 1/4 cup flax seeds

For the Jam:

  • 1 cup berries
  • 4 tablespoons chia seeds

For the Chocolate:

  • 1/2 cup coconut nectar or date paste
  • 3/4 cup cacao powder
  • 1/3 cup coconut oil or cacao butter, melted

Preparation

To Make the Base:

  1. Grind the rolled oats into flour in a blender, then mix together with the other ingredients in a bowl.
  2. Press into the bottom of a lined bread pan.
  3. Put in the fridge.

To Make the Jam:

  1. Mash or blend the berries until smooth, then thoroughly stir in the chia seeds and let it sit for 10-15 minutes so the chia seeds can gel with the mashed berries and thicken into jam.
  2. Spread this onto your base, then drizzle on the chocolate evenly. Stick it back in the fridge and let sit for an hour, then slice and munch!

To Make the Chocolate: 

  1. Mix all ingredients until smooth and ridiculously delicious-looking.
  2. Spread the chocolate love out on some wax paper (or if making chocolate chips - dollop on with a spoon or icing bag) and put it in the fridge for an hour.
